<b>Trawler explodes off Sri Lanka coast, gunrunning suspected+</b>

(Japan Economic Newswire Via Thomson Dialog NewsEdge)COLOMBO, Feb. 11_(Kyodo) _ A fishing trawler exploded at sea off Sri Lanka's northeastern Mannar coast on Saturday when approached by navy vessels for inspection, Sri Lankan navy sources said.



"The boat exploded as two naval fast-attack craft approached it for inspection," a senior naval officer said. "There had been no offensive action on either side."

"All on board are presumed dead," he said, adding that he had no information on how many there were.

The naval vessels patrolling the area had approached the trawler due to its suspicious movements, said the officer, who requested anonymity.

The Tamil Tiger rebels have previously exploded gunrunning boats to prevent detection.

Earlier this year, the navy detected an Indian trawler carrying 65,000 detonators for delivery to the rebels. Diplomats expressed concern about the incident ahead of talks slated for Feb. 22 in Geneva between the Sri Lanka government and the rebels to discuss their February 2002 Cease-Fire Agreement.

It would be the first meeting between the two sides since April 2003.

<b>S.Lanka boat explodes as navy goes to search it</b>
Sat 11 Feb 2006 8:01 AM ET
COLOMBO, Feb 11 (Reuters) - A fishing boat exploded when a Sri Lankan naval patrol boat approached it near rebel Tamil Tiger territory on Saturday, international truce monitors said they had been told by the military.

A military source said it might have been a rebel Sea Tiger boat that blew itself up when stopped by a naval patrol rather than be searched. A naval spokesman said he had no precise details of the incident, but that one sailor had been wounded.

"The report from the navy is that it was a fishing boat and when the Dvora (naval patrol boat) approached, there was an explosion on board," said Helen Olafsdottir, spokeswoman for the Nordic mission which monitors a 2002 ceasefire.

A string of suspected rebel attacks on troops in the minority Tamil dominated north and east pushed Sri Lanka to the brink of war, but tensions have fallen since late January when the two sides agreed to hold direct talks in Switzerland.

<b>Boat explosion reported off Mannar, four feared killed</b>

[TamilNet, February 11, 2006 13:58 GMT]
At least four persons were feared killed in an explosion involving a boat off the seas of Pesalai in Mannar, Saturday afternoon Police said. Sri Lankan Police, said those on board the suspect vessel set the explosion that destroyed the boat when a Sri Lanka Navy (SLN) vessel tried to intercept the boat. Meanwhile, fishermen in Pesalai, expressed fears that the victims could be civilians travelling in a boat with high horsepower engines, that came under RPG fire from the SLN vessel.
Fishermen in Pesalai witnessed smoke from the explosion till 7:00 p.m.

An SLN sailor, who fell unconscious following the incident, was transferred to Anuradhapura hospital for treatment, Police said.

Suspected Tamil Tigers explode own vessel transporting explosives, Navy says </b>

Associated Press, Sat February 11, 2006 08:32 EST . COLOMBO, Sri Lanka - (AP) Suspected Tamil Tiger rebels on Saturday exploded their own boat believed to be transporting explosives off Sri Lanka - 's northwestern sea, a navy official said.
Navy patrol crafts spotted a suspicious fishing vessel and went to investigate in the sea of Talaimannar, 250 kilometers (155 miles) northwest of Colombo, when the explosion occurred, the official said on condition of anonymity because he is not authorized to speak to the media.

மன்னாரில் வெடிப்பொருட்களை ஏற்றிவந்த படகு வெடித்துள்ளதாக கடற்படையினர் கூறுகின்றனர்.

<img src='http://www.bbc.co.uk/worldservice/images/2006/02/20060211165536lankanavyboat203.jpg' border='0' alt='user posted image'>

இலங்கையின் வடமேற்கே மன்னார் கடற்பரப்பில் வெடிபொருட்களை ஏற்றிவந்த மீன்பிடிப்படகு ஒன்று வெடித்துச் சிதறியதாக இலங்கை படையினர் தெரிவித்துள்ளனர்.

இரணைதீவுக்கும், தலைமன்னாருக்கும் இடையே இரணைதீவுக்கு தென்மேற்காக 8 கடல்மைல் தொலைவில் இந்தச் சம்பவம் நடந்ததாகவும், வெடிபொருட்களை ஏற்றிவந்த பயங்கரவாதிகளின் பன்முகச் செயற்திறன்கொண்ட படகு ஒன்றே இவ்வாறு வெடித்ததாகவும் இலங்கை இராணுவத்தின் பேச்சாளர் பிரிகேடியர்பிரசாத் சமரசிங்க தெரிவித்துள்ளார்.

கடற்படையினர் அந்தப்படகை சோதனை செய்ய முற்பட்ட போது அந்தப்படகில் இருந்தவர்கள் தமது படகைத் தாமே வெடிக்கச் செய்ததாகவும் அவர் கூறினார்.

இந்தப் படகு வெடித்தபோது அதில் இருந்தவர்களுக்கு என்ன நடந்தது என்று தெரியாது என்றும், இந்தச் சம்பவத்தில் கடற்படைச் சிப்பாய் ஒருவர் காயமடைந்ததாகவும் இராணுவப் பேச்சாளர் கூறினார்.
